What is the SCHD ETF?
Before diving into the annualized dividend calculator, it is beneficial to comprehend what SCHD is. SCHD is an exchange-traded fund that intends to track the efficiency of the Dow Jones U.S. Dividend 100 Index. This index consists of high dividend-yielding U.S. stocks that meet certain financial criteria, such as a history of consistent dividend payments. The annualized dividend is essentially the total dividends paid by an investment over a year, assuming that the dividends stay constant throughout. This can be an excellent metric for investors who wish to comprehend their possible cash flow from dividends. For SCHD, this metric is essential for anticipating income and evaluating the fund's efficiency against other investments.
Comprehending the Annualized Dividend Formula
The formula to calculate the annualized dividend is rather easy:

Annualized Dividend = (Dividend per Share) x (Number of Dividend Payments in a Year)

This straightforward computation allows financiers to anticipate their income from dividends properly.

To highlight, let's say SCHD pays a quarterly dividend of ₤ 0.50. Here's how you would calculate the annualized dividend:

Annualized Dividend = ₤ 0.50 x 4 = ₤ 2.00

Example Calculation
Let's presume a financier has an interest in investing ₤ 10,000 in SCHD, which has a quarterly dividend of ₤ 0.50. Here's how the calculator will yield annualized dividend information:
Investment Amount: ₤ 10,000Quarterly Dividend: ₤ 0.50Number of Payments: 4
Annualized Dividend = (₤ 0.50 x 4) x (10,000/ Price of SCHD)

If, for instance, the [schd dividend frequency](https://pad.hacknang.de/RRWpp3m2QeSFgpzoGZKqrA/) share rate is ₤ 76, the variety of shares purchased would be roughly 131.58. For that reason, the formula supplies:

Annualized Dividend = ₤ 2.00 x 131.58 = ₤ 263.16

In this circumstance, the financier can anticipate to earn approximately ₤ 263.16 from dividends in a year based upon existing dividends and financial investment.

2. How can I reinvest dividends from SCHD?
Answer: Most brokerage platforms offer a Dividend Reinvestment Plan (DRIP), allowing you to instantly reinvest dividends into more shares of the ETF.
3. Does SCHD have a history of increasing dividends?
Answer: Yes, SCHD concentrates on companies with a performance history of increasing dividends in time, making it an appealing choice for income-focused investors.
4. What are the tax implications of dividends from SCHD?
Response: Dividends are normally taxed as ordinary income. However, qualified dividends might have beneficial tax rates. It's best to consult a tax expert for individualized recommendations.
5. How typically does SCHD pay dividends?
Answer: SCHD pays dividends quarterly, typically in March, June, September, and December.
